In this episode of Collector Conversations, Tim sits down with Beth, a chief of police who has developed a deep passion for watch collecting. Beth shares her perspectives on the hobby, discussing her philosophies on curating a meaningful collection and the stories behind standout pieces like her Tudor Black Bay Bronze BB43 and Breitling Navitimer. She also highlights her admiration for brands like Rado and Cartier and reveals her vision for where her collection might go next.
